摘要
In distributed collaborative systems for semantic stores editing, multiple users can add, delete and change RDF statements starting from the same replicas and achieving to the same results at the end of the collaborative session. To improve the performance for such systems, the development of an efficient awareness mechanism is very important in order to help users to better understand the semantic stores evolution. Moreover, maintaining the consistency in replicated architecture is one of the most significant problems. However, none of the existing approaches describes how to define the awareness mechanism for distributed semantic stores performing concurrent changes. In this paper, we propose a new powerful optimistic replication solution called AB-Set, which can ensure not only a consistency criteria when editing data but also use semantic web technologies to define an awareness mechanism for making users aware of the different status of the store they share and update regardless of the concurrency level.
